The Sea-Dweller is the technological advance of the Submariner. It is slightly thicker and has a helium escape valve. In the 1960’s, professional divers operated from diving bells. The helium valve allows helium atoms to escape during decompression, thus preventing implosion.

The Sea-Dweller is less known and less produced than the Submariner, which makes it a naturally sought-after watch today.

Design in the pure DNA of Rolex, a watch for professional divers who use it safely up to 610 m (2000 ft).

The model presented here is particular, all the writings seem white (Albinos).

A rare model in this configuration.

It is a stainless steel round case of 40 mm diameter. Faded black dial with luminescent painted indexes.

Bidirectional rotating bezel, 60-mn graduated to calculate dive or decompression times. Luminescent Mercedes hands. Self-winding mechanical movement, chronometer certified.
